Trademark Infringement
The unauthorized use of a trademark or service mark on or in connection with goods and/or services in a manner that is likely to cause confusion, deception, or mistake about the source of the goods and/or services.
Likelihood of Confusion
This refers to a standard used in trademark law to assess whether the similarity between two marks is likely to confuse consumers about the source of the products or services.
Trade Secret
A form of intellectual property comprising confidential information that provides a business with a competitive edge.
